This summer, the St. Clement’s Island Museum in Southern Maryland is hosting the Art Kids program, offering young artists aged 7 to 17 hands-on workshops centered around the theme "Southern Maryland Animals Great and Small." Led by local instructor Ellen Duke Wilson, the four themed workshops—Sketching, Painting, Collage, and Sculpting—run from June to August 2025, focusing on artistic techniques inspired by regional wildlife. Each three-day session culminates in a completed artwork for a public exhibit during Children’s Day on Aug. 17, 2025. Open to all skill levels, the $5 program encourages creativity and confidence. Pre-registration is mandatory, with materials provided. The St. Mary’s County Museum Division organizes this event as part of its mission to preserve and interpret local cultural history.
Northport city leaders, alongside former Alabama First Lady Terry Saban, celebrated the opening of a new playground funded by Nick’s Kids, the charitable foundation of Nick and Terry Saban. This initiative, supported by Northport Council President Christy Bobo, aims to enhance community spaces for children. The playground at Civitan Park represents a collaborative effort emphasizing the importance of outdoor play for child development. Terry Saban highlighted the significance of such projects in fostering social skills and healthy lifestyles among children. Additionally, she announced the upcoming groundbreaking of the $150 million Saban Center in Tuscaloosa, which will feature a hands-on museum, STEM center, and space for the Tuscaloosa Children’s Theater, promoting education and innovation statewide.

A group of parents in Brookline, Massachusetts, has formed Brookline Kids Unplugged to delay introducing smartphones and social media to their children until they are 14 and 16 years old, respectively. This initiative aims to prevent potential mental health and developmental issues linked to excessive screen time. Unlike other groups, Brookline Kids Unplugged emphasizes fostering real-world play and independence through organized meetups and playdates. Co-founder Michelle Lai notes the group seeks to build solidarity among parents and community among kids. With 68 students currently involved, participants express positive sentiments about the initiative, valuing offline activities such as sports, crafts, and reading over screen time. The movement aligns with a broader national trend addressing the negative impacts of technology on youth.

Today's children are growing up in a world deeply integrated with technology, particularly artificial intelligence (AI). AI is becoming a normal part of daily life, influencing education, parenting, and even therapy. Sam Altman, CEO of OpenAI, shares how he relies on ChatGPT for parenting advice and envisions his children using AI extensively, acknowledging that they may never surpass its intelligence but will be adept at leveraging it. However, experts warn about potential downsides, such as hindering language and social development due to lack of human interaction and privacy concerns. A tragic case involving a teenager highlights the risks of parasocial relationships with AI. Altman recognizes both the tremendous benefits and challenges AI poses, emphasizing the need for societal adaptation to manage its impact responsibly.

Milan Fashion Week Men’s S/S 2026 is set to be a highlight in the fashion calendar, following the quieter Pitti Uomo event in Florence. Key Italian designers such as Giorgio Armani, Emporio Armani, Dolce & Gabbana, and Prada will showcase their latest collections, with Prada's presentation likely to define the season's trends. Notably, there is a strong British presence, including Dunhill and Sir Paul Smith, who shifts his show from Paris to Milan, celebrating his long-standing connection with the city. Young designer Saul Nash also joins the lineup. The week will feature various presentations and events across Milan, emphasizing the city's rich design heritage.
